How a dehumidifier works in Ballig
The idea is simple: the unit draws in damp air, the moisture condenses and collects in a tank (or drains away), and drier air is pushed back into the room. For a cellar or cold room in Ballig, you'll want a model suited to cool spaces and matched to the volume you're drying.

How long until I see a difference in Ballig?
It depends how wet things are: a damp room clears in days, while drying-out works in Ballig may need a week or more of continuous running.
Will a dehumidifier get rid of black mould?
A dehumidifier tackles the cause: the excess moisture mould needs to grow. Clean the existing mould off, then keep the air dry and it won't keep returning in Ballig.
